Overview

The Ismailia International Film Festival for Documentaries and Short Films is one of Egypt's most important film festivals, dedicated exclusively to documentary and short form cinema. Founded in 1992 in Ismailia, a city on the Suez Canal between Cairo and the Sinai Peninsula, the festival screens films from Egypt, Africa, and the Arab world alongside an international selection.

The festival occupies a distinctive niche in the Arab film calendar by focusing specifically on documentary and short films rather than narrative features. This focus makes it the most important platform for Arab documentary filmmakers seeking regional recognition and exposure.

Egypt has the most established film industry in the Arab world, with a tradition of production and distribution infrastructure that extends back to the 1920s. The Cairo International Film Festival handles narrative features, while Ismailia serves the nonfiction and short film community.

Key Sections

  • Arab Documentary Competition -- documentaries from the Arab world
  • African Documentary Competition -- documentaries from Africa
  • International Documentary Program -- international nonfiction
  • Arab Short Film Competition -- short films from the Arab world
  • Egyptian Cinema -- new Egyptian documentary and short work

What Filmmakers Should Know

Ismailia accepts open submissions. For Arab documentary filmmakers, the festival provides the most targeted regional competitive platform available. Egyptian, North African, and broader Arab documentary work all find natural homes in the programming.

The festival's location in Ismailia rather than Cairo gives it a distinctive identity outside the Egyptian capital's more cosmopolitan film culture.

Major Awards

  • Golden Isis Award -- Best Arab Documentary
  • Best African Documentary
  • Best Arab Short Film
  • Special Jury Prize

Festival History

Ismailia International Film Festival was founded in 1992 under the auspices of Egypt's Ministry of Culture and has operated as one of the official Egyptian film festivals since then.
